It's National Vocation Awareness Week Nov. 1-7
National Vocation Awareness Week is now underway through November 7. This is an ideal time to promote religious life on social media, recognize the vocations of your community members, and deliver a vocation message in schools and sponsored ministries. NRVC has created 19 new videos for sharing and is launching them throughout the week on Facebook; they will be on our YouTube channel as well. In addition, NRVC offers a new, downloadable resource, "Fifty Fun Facts." Find background, ideas, and resources for the week here.
